The cheapest way to get from Natural History Museum to Baker Street is to subway via Green Park station which costs £2 - £12 and takes 22 min.
The fastest way to get from Natural History Museum to Baker Street is to taxi which takes 10 min and costs £27 - £32.
Yes, there is a direct bus departing from Natural History Museum /Queens Gate and arriving at Old Marylebone Town Hall. Services depart every 10 minutes, and operate every day. The journey takes approximately 31 min.
Yes, there is a direct train departing from South Kensington station station and arriving at Edgware Road. Services depart every 10 minutes, and operate every day. The journey takes approximately 17 min.
The distance between Natural History Museum and Baker Street is 4 miles.
The best way to get from Natural History Museum to Baker Street without a car is to subway via Green Park station which takes 22 min and costs £2 - £12.
It takes approximately 22 min to get from Natural History Museum to Baker Street, including transfers.
